Consumer Description
The contact owned a 2019 Hyundai Tucson. The contact stated while driving approximately 55 MPH the vehicle started smoking and overheating. The contact was able to pull over safely. There were no warning lights on the instrument panel. Once the vehicle stopped the doors were automatically locked. The nearby drivers notified the contact of the fire under the vehicle. Once the contact exited the vehicle, the engine was destroyed by the fire. The inside of the vehicle was still functional. The state police arrived on the scene; however, a police report has not been obtained. The fire department also arrived and extinguished the fire. The vehicle was towed to a wrecking yard. The manufacturer was not notified of the failure. There were no injuries or medical reports. The approximate failure mileage was 40,000.
